UPDATES with more information: Hot off-broadway company The New Group announced today that Richard Chamberlain will return to the New York stage in its previously announced fall revival of David Rabe’s Sticks And Bones. Cast includes Holly Hunter and Bill Pullman, along with Nadia Gan, Morocco Omari, Ben Schnetzer and Raviv Ullman. Previews will begin in October and the run will continue through December 14. Director is New Group honcho Scott Elliott. Company will be playing this season at the Pershing Square Signature Center.
Rabe’s 1971 play was part of a Vietnam War trilogy that began with The Basic Training Of Pavlo Hummel and followed by Streamers. Sticks And Bones is a brutal parody of The Ozzie And Harriet show sitcom, in which a blind vet returns home from the war but is unable to cope with his memories, his family and his disability.
